QUOTE(spunkberry @ Jul 26 2017, 05:10 AM) You cannot simply change your cat's litter whenever you like. Cats hate change, so you have to transition him slowly back and forth whenever you want to change anything - this also applies to food. Cats also generally do not do well when you move them around because they are bound to their territory. Moving him from your place to your hometown and back probably stressed him out, as well as the different litter. What I recommend you do is take him to the vet to rule out any medical issues, instead of assuming it's just the type of litter.
